{"data":{"id":"us/5-cfr-2424.41","jurisdiction":"us","citation":"5 CFR 2424.41","heading":"Compliance.","body":"The exclusive representative may report to the appropriate Regional Director an agency's failure to comply with an order issued in accordance with § 2424.40. The exclusive representative must report such failure within a reasonable period of time following expiration of the 60-day period under 5 U.S.C. 7123(a), which begins on the date of issuance of the Authority order. If, on referral from the Regional Director, the Authority finds such a failure to comply with its order, the Authority will take whatever action it deems necessary to secure compliance with its order, including enforcement under 5 U.S.C. 7123(b).","path":["Title 5—Administrative Personnel","CHAPTER XIV—FEDERAL LABOR RELATIONS AUTHORITY, GENERAL COUNSEL OF THE FEDERAL LABOR RELATIONS AUTHORITY AND FEDERAL SERVICE IMPASSES PANEL","SUBCHAPTER C—FEDERAL LABOR RELATIONS AUTHORITY AND GENERAL COUNSEL OF THE FEDERAL LABOR RELATIONS AUTHORITY","PART 2424—NEGOTIABILITY PROCEEDINGS","Subpart E—Decision and Order"],"source_url":"https://www.ecfr.gov/api/versioner/v1/full/2026-08-25/title-5.xml","current_through":"2026-08-25","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-08-27T02:23:53Z","sha256":"21517f7600b4f588d0f58bb13ddbcfa05cf337450ebdd21f7ca81ea930667543","source_id":"us-cfr","stale":true,"prev":"us/5-cfr-2424.40","next":"us/5-cfr-2424.42-2424.49"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
